Usually Melbourne winters cool down the real estate market. With a lack of leaves on the trees, colour in the garden, shoes required to be taken off at the open for inspections and rain coming from all directions, most don't see it as an optimal time to be selling their biggest asset. Yet with a lack of property on the market, and those looking to settle before Christmas, those who choose to sell their properties on the market seem to be able to get a sale price that's beyond their expectations. So today's podcast is all about the benefits of selling through winter.
